172. Blood test for oral shingles result

The result came back for the Varicella Zoster Virus VZV (Herpes) Ab IgM.  It states that the virus is present and that I have antibodies to it but that there was no serological evidence of acute infection.   (The blood sample was taken after the infection had subsided.)  I do not know how to interpret these results.  Mary (former nurse) says this means that I did have oral shingles.  If that's the case it means that the ordeal is not directly related to my present medication which I was afraid of since having oral lesions is one of it's side effects. But it does mean that my immunity is suffering.  Anyway, the problem is resolved and I do not have any infection or sores in my mouth anymore at the moment.  Yes!!!
